Как скопировать таблицу из одной базы в другую SQL: пошаговое руководство
CREATE TABLE новая_таблица AS
SELECT * FROM старая_таблица;
В этом примере мы создаем новую таблицу с помощью оператора CREATE TABLE и затем заполняем ее данными, выбирая все строки и столбцы из старой таблицы с помощью оператора SELECT. Замените "новая_таблица" на имя новой таблицы, которую вы хотите создать, и "старая_таблица" на имя существующей таблицы, которую вы хотите скопировать.
Не забудьте убедиться, что таблицы и базы данных находятся в одной системе управления базами данных (СУБД), такой как MySQL, PostgreSQL или Oracle.
Если вы хотите копировать таблицу со всеми ее ограничениями, индексами и триггерами, вам потребуется использовать более сложные инструменты, такие как команда SQL Dump. Более подробная информация о копировании таблиц из одной базы данных в другую в SQL можно найти в официальной документации вашей СУБД.
Детальный ответ
Как скопировать таблицу из одной базы в другую с использованием SQL
Вам нужно скопировать таблицу из одной базы данных в другую? Нет проблем! В этой статье я подробно объясню, как выполнить эту задачу с использованием языка SQL.
Шаг 1: Создайте новую таблицу в целевой базе данных
Первым шагом вам потребуется создать новую таблицу в целевой базе данных. Этот шаг необходим для того, чтобы вы могли скопировать данные из исходной таблицы в новую таблицу.
Вот пример создания новой таблицы с использованием языка SQL:
CREATE TABLE target_table (
column1 datatype,
column2 datatype,
...
);
Шаг 2: Выберите данные из исходной таблицы
После создания новой таблицы вам нужно выбрать данные из исходной таблицы, чтобы скопировать их в новую таблицу. Для этого воспользуйтесь оператором SELECT и указываете исходную таблицу.
Вот пример выборки данных из исходной таблицы:
SELECT column1, column2, ...
FROM source_table;
Шаг 3: Вставьте выбранные данные в новую таблицу
Теперь, когда у вас есть выбранные данные, вы можете вставить их в новую таблицу, используя оператор INSERT INTO.
Вот пример вставки данных в новую таблицу:
INSERT INTO target_table (column1, column2, ...)
VALUES (value1, value2, ...);
Шаг 4: Проверьте результат
После выполнения вышеперечисленных шагов внимательно проверьте результат. Убедитесь, что все данные были успешно скопированы из исходной таблицы в новую таблицу.
Пример полного SQL-запроса:
CREATE TABLE target_table (
column1 datatype,
column2 datatype,
...
);
INSERT INTO target_table (column1, column2, ...)
SELECT column1, column2, ...
FROM source_table;
Теперь вы знаете, как скопировать таблицу из одной базы данных в другую с использованием языка SQL. Просто следуйте вышеуказанным шагам, и ваша таблица будет успешно скопирована.
Удачи в вашем программировании!